Scope and Content 18th century cottage, listed as having ‘slight alterations’ and being ‘restored by J Wilson Paterson for Edinburgh Corporation 1959-62’. The skews of the building are lower than the depth of the thatch and a cement fillet has been put in place to secure the thatch at the skews. The listed building description reads ‘raised skews’, so it would appear the skews or level of the thatch has been altered since the date of listing. The thatch is extremely neat and is left entirely uncovered, and the concrete ridge appears in a new condition. Part of a group of thatched cottages of the same period (see surveys 059-062 & 064 for the other entries).
